- We keep cows and calves on our lands at home.
They live in a stable at night and there is name on this stable - it is called the cow house.
They are let out early in the mornings, and they are brought home in the evenings. When we are driving them home we say [?].
The cows give us milk to drink which is very healthy.
The bedding under them is straw or rushes.
